To further promote international exchanges, China has decided to expand its list of visa-exempt countries. Starting from July 1, 2024, to December 31, 2025, citizens holding ordinary passports from New Zealand, Australia, and Poland can enter China without a visa for stays up to 15 days for business, tourism, family visits, or transit. Individuals from these countries who do not meet the visa exemption criteria will still need to obtain a visa before entering China.
